Foros del Web » Programación para mayores de 30 ;) » .NET »

Pasar password en consulta

Estas en el tema de Pasar password en consulta en el foro de .NET en Foros del Web. Tengo esta consulta para copiar datos de una tabla a otra tabla de otra BD distinta. (access) por ejemplo: Cita: "insert into tabla in 'c:\bdDestino.mdb' ...
  #1 (permalink)  
Antiguo 25/05/2007, 11:28
Avatar de freegirl
Colaborador
 
Fecha de Ingreso: octubre-2003
Ubicación: Catalonia
Mensajes: 4.334
Antigüedad: 20 años, 7 meses
Puntos: 156
Pregunta Pasar password en consulta

Tengo esta consulta para copiar datos de una tabla a otra tabla de otra BD distinta. (access)

por ejemplo:

Cita:
"insert into tabla in 'c:\bdDestino.mdb' select tabla.* from tabla in 'c:\BDOrigen.mdb'"
Esto funciona correctamente salvo que las BD tengan contraseña.

¿Como puedo pasarle la contraseña de la BD en esa misma consulta?

saludos
  #2 (permalink)  
Antiguo 26/05/2007, 09:14
Avatar de freegirl
Colaborador
 
Fecha de Ingreso: octubre-2003
Ubicación: Catalonia
Mensajes: 4.334
Antigüedad: 20 años, 7 meses
Puntos: 156
De acuerdo Re: Pasar password en consulta

Bueno al final encontré la solución.

Por ejemplo:

Código:
Dim destino as string ="[MS Access;DATABASE=c:\bdDestino.mdb;Uid=admin;Pwd=miPassword;]"
Dim origen as string = "[MS Access;DATABASE=c:\bdOrigen.mdb;Uid=admin;Pwd=miPassword;]"

conn.open
cmd.connection =conn
cmd.commandtext = "INSERT INTO " & destino  ".tabla SELECT * FROM " & origen & ".tabla"
cmd.executeNonQuery
conn.close
saludos
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 06:50.